Analysis
The most recent figure for population, age 16, total in Turkmenistan is 90,762, measured in 2015.
That represents a change of down 7.4% on the previous year and down 21.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population, age 16, total in Turkmenistan peaked at 117,403 in 2007 and was at its lowest, 76,711, in 1990.
That places Turkmenistan 107th out of 191 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 86,164 | 76,711 | 96,233 | 10 |
| 2000s | 111,442 | 99,225 | 117,403 | 10 |
| 2010s | 102,489 | 90,762 | 112,225 | 5 |
